WebIt can take another day or two for the amount to change status from "Pending" to "Completed" within your credit card account. Note that tipped workers don't receive your tips immediately if you pay with a card. Legally, they must receive their tips by the next pay period-but this can be a week or two after your card is charged by the merchant. WebCredit card statement due date changes won't take effect immediately. Usually, the change in date will be active in 1 or 2 billing cycles after you make the request. Until the date change is official, you'll have to pay your credit card bill by its current due date.
